Austenitic stainless steel like 304 stainless steel compared with carbon steel, has the following characteristics:
1) It has high electrical resistivity, about 5 times over the carbon steel.
2) Its linear expansion coefficient is 40% larger than carbon steel, and with the temperature rise, the value of stainless steel screw linear expansion coefficient increases accordingly.
3) It has low thermal conductivity, roughly is 1/3 of carbon steel.
Whether the stainless steel plate or heat-resistant steel plate, austenitic steel plate has the best overall performance. Because of its good strength, excellent plasticity and not high stiffness, it is widely used in many fields.
Austenitic stainless steel is similar to most other metal materials, its tensile strength, yield strength and hardness are strengthened with the temperature decreases, while the plasticity is weakened with the temperature decreases. Its tensile strength in the temperature range of 15 ~ 80 ° C increases more uniform.
More importantly, along with temperature going down, the toughness of stainless steel rivet nut weakens very slowly, therefore, stainless steel at low temperatures can maintain adequate plasticity and toughness. Heat resistance refers to the thermal stability and thermostrength, which is anti-oxidation or resistance to gas corrosion, maintains good strength in high temperatures.
